20分钟搭好专属测试用例Skill,效率直提8倍(附模板+可复制Prompt)

在上一篇文章中,我和大家分享了Agent + Skill 协作提效的核心方法论:

Agent 负责理解复杂任务、规划执行路径;Skill 负责封装可复用的专业能力。两者结合,就是给AI助手配备一套随取随用的专属工具箱。

文章发出后,很多测试同行私信提问:
Skill 到底该怎么从零创建?
有没有完整、可落地、能直接照搬的实操案例?

今天这篇就一次性讲透。
全程20分钟完整实战,手把手带你用 skill-creator 搭建专属「测试用例生成器」Skill,学完直接落地到日常项目,告别手写用例的重复加班。

先说真实落地效果,再讲实操方法

先看对比,直观感受这套Skill的提效价值:

指标 传统手动方式 Skill自动化方式
技能一次性搭建 约 20 分钟
单次需求出用例 手动编写 2~3 天 一键调用,仅需 2 分钟
测试覆盖率 约 75% 92% 以上
用例质量标准 依赖个人经验,参差不齐 统一规范,标准化输出

核心关键:
20分钟属于一次性投入,后续所有新需求、迭代需求、回归场景,直接调用Skill即可快速产出。
真正帮你砍掉低效重复工作,把时间留给核心测试与风险把控。


01 快速读懂:什么是 skill-creator?

用大白话解释:
skill-creator 是内置在 CodeBuddy 等AI代码助手的轻量化能力,核心作用只有一句话:
让普通人也能快速自制专属AI工具。

无需了解Skill底层架构、不用写配置代码、不用懂复杂规则。
你只需要清晰描述业务需求、输出规范、场景要求,AI自动帮你生成完整、可直接使用的标准化Skill。


02 从零实战:手把手搭建测试用例生成Skill

第一步:简单认识Skill基础结构

先快速过一遍标准目录结构,不用死记,skill-creator会自动生成90%内容:

skill-name/
├── SKILL.md (核心必需文件)
│   ├── YAML frontmatter 元数据
│   └── Markdown 执行指令&规范
├── scripts/          # 可扩展执行脚本
├── references/       # 团队规范参考文档
└── assets/          # 配图、模板资源

整体轻量化、易维护、易迭代,完全适配测试团队日常使用。

第二步:复制即用|调用skill-creator创建技能

打开CodeBuddy,直接复制下方Prompt,按需微调即可:

帮我创建一个测试用例生成器的 Skill,名称叫 test-case-generator。
功能:根据业务功能描述,自动生成结构化、标准化测试用例
硬性要求:
1. 必须覆盖:正常流程、异常操作、边界条件、权限校验四大核心场景
2. 每个功能点标配:1条正向用例 + 3条及以上异常/边界场景
3. 固定表格输出,字段包含:用例编号、前置条件、测试步骤、预期结果、场景类型
4. 优先覆盖用户高频操作、核心业务链路、高危边界场景
5. 贴合软件测试行业通用规范,适配功能测试、回归测试场景

发送后自动激活 skill-creator,AI 会全自动拆解需求、生成完整Skill文件。

第三步:预览成品|自动生成完整标准化Skill

工具会直接产出完整可落地的 SKILL.md,核心内容如下:

---
name: test-case-generator
description: 根据功能描述自动生成结构化的测试用例。适用于编写测试用例、验证功能完整性、回归测试设计等场景。当用户提到"生成测试用例"、"编写测试"、"测试覆盖"、"测试场景"等意图时触发此技能。
---

# 测试用例生成技能

根据功能描述自动生成结构化的测试用例,涵盖正常流程、异常操作、边界条件和权限校验四类场景。

## 测试用例生成模板

生成测试用例时,按照以下结构输出:

### 1. 功能概述
简要描述待测试的功能点

### 2. 测试用例表格

| 用例编号 | 用例名称 | 前置条件 | 测试步骤 | 预期结果 | 场景类型 |
|---------|---------|---------|---------|---------|---------|
| TC-001 | xxx | xxx | xxx | xxx | 正常流程 |
| TC-002 | xxx | xxx | xxx | xxx | 异常操作 |
| ... | ... | ... | ... | ... | ... |

## 四类场景覆盖要求

### 1. 正常流程 (Positive Scenarios)
- 功能的核心业务流程
- 用户最常执行的路径
- 端到端的完整操作链

### 2. 异常操作 (Negative Scenarios)
- 输入合法性校验
- 空值/边界值处理
- 重复操作处理
- 流程中断与恢复

### 3. 边界条件 (Boundary Conditions)
- 等价类边界值
- 最大/最小输入
- 特殊字符处理
- 格式校验边界

### 4. 权限校验 (Permission/Auth Scenarios)
- 未登录访问
- 无权限操作
- 跨角色访问
- 越权操作防护

## 用例命名规范

- 用例编号格式:`TC-{功能模块}-{序号}`,如 `TC-LOGIN-001`
- 用例名称:清晰表达测试意图,如 `用户名正确且密码正确时登录成功`

## 输出示例

### 功能:用户登录

| 用例编号 | 用例名称 | 前置条件 | 测试步骤 | 预期结果 | 场景类型 |
|---------|---------|---------|---------|---------|---------|
| TC-LOGIN-001 | 正确账号密码登录成功 | 用户已注册 | 1. 输入正确用户名<br>2. 输入正确密码<br>3. 点击登录 | 登录成功,进入首页 | 正常流程 |
| TC-LOGIN-002 | 密码错误登录失败 | 用户已注册 | 1. 输入正确用户名<br>2. 输入错误密码<br>3. 点击登录 | 提示密码错误 | 异常操作 |
| TC-LOGIN-003 | 用户名为空登录 | 无 | 1. 用户名留空<br>2. 输入密码<br>3. 点击登录 | 提示用户名不能为空 | 边界条件 |
| TC-LOGIN-004 | 未注册用户登录 | 用户未注册 | 1. 输入未注册用户名<br>2. 输入密码<br>3. 点击登录 | 提示用户不存在 | 异常操作 |
| TC-LOGIN-005 | 无权限访问管理后台 | 普通用户登录 | 1. 登录为普通用户<br>2. 访问管理后台 | 提示无权限访问 | 权限校验 |

## 优先级建议

生成用例时可根据功能重要性标注优先级:
- **P0**: 核心功能,阻断性问题
- **P1**: 重要功能,非阻断但影响使用
- **P2**: 边缘功能,体验相关

## 生成流程

1. 分析功能描述,识别核心功能点
2. 针对每个功能点设计正向用例
3. 补充异常、边界、权限用例
4. 整理成表格格式输出
5. 确保每个功能点至少包含正向+异常场景

生成完成后,你可以按需二次编辑:
替换成公司内部用例规范、命名规则、字段自定义,一键定制团队专属版本,同时自动在 references 目录生成配套参考模板。

第四步:一键调用|实战生成业务测试用例

Skill部署完成后,直接用指令快速调用,示范如下:

/test-case-generator 快速生成完整测试用例
业务需求:临时调额
- 客户经理可为客户发起临时调额申请,需填写:调额类型(单笔/单日)、申请额度、有效期、调额原因。  
- 调额申请提交后,系统自动进行风控评分:  
  - 评分 < 30 分 → 自动通过,立即生效。  
  - 评分 30~60 分 → 进入一级审批(主管),审批通过后生效。  
  - 评分 > 60 分 → 自动拒绝,并建议客户至柜面办理。  
- 临时调额生效期间,原静态限额被覆盖;到期后自动恢复原限额。  
- 支持查询调额历史记录,并可对生效中的调额进行「提前撤销」。

秒级输出全套结构化用例,覆盖全场景无遗漏。

640-1

同时支持扩展能力:
✅ 一键导出Excel用例文件
✅ 对接内部测试平台,用例直接入库
✅ 批量迭代、补充回归用例

只要是重复性、标准化的测试工作,都可以用这套思路自定义封装。


03 实操避坑|3条落地关键建议

  1. 新建Skill时,Prompt务必写清场景范围+输出格式,避免用例覆盖不全、格式混乱;
  2. 首次生成后,建议嵌入团队专属规范,后续永久复用,统一全员输出标准;
  3. 支持动态迭代,用例不符合业务要求时,直接补充指令微调,快速优化Skill规则。

写在最后

本篇是「Agent + Skill」系列干货的承接落地篇,再梳理一遍核心逻辑:

  • Agent:负责复杂需求理解、任务拆解、路径规划
  • Skill:沉淀专业测试能力,做成可复用工具
  • skill-creator:低代码自研AI工具,实现测试提效闭环

AI测试的下一阶段,从来不是单纯套用别人的工具。
而是根据自己的业务、团队、流程,打造专属生产力工具
20分钟一次性搭建,长期复用降本,才是测试提效的核心解法。


💡福利领取
如果这份实战内容对你有帮助,
关注我,分享给身边做测试的小伙伴~

私信我免费领取:
✅ 完整成品Skill文件
✅ 可直接复制的创建Prompt
✅ 测试用例标准模板

posted @ 2026-05-06 10:10  AITest研究员  阅读(10)  评论(0)    收藏  举报